Had a patient I am treating for RA who is taking methotrexate. She had been

trying to wean herself off but the RA kept flaring up.

She is successfully reducing the dose now with a prescription.(Curcumera,

filipendula, zingiber, glyc. glabra, apium)

She had a recent blood test from the GP that showed raised MCV - probably due to

the methotrextae and too much alcohol(Hmmm - 1 beer and 2 wine daily)

Gave Carduus 5 ml tds for 2 weeks. (She didn't reduce the booze - sigh.) The MCV

has now returned to normal.
